Telmiwal-40 Tablet is used to treat hypertension (high blood pressure) in adults and to reduce the risk of heart attack or stroke in adults. Essential hypertension is a medical condition in which the blood pressure is elevated persistently in the arteries without any known cause. On the other hand, heart attack or stroke occurs due to blocked blood flow to the heart or brain, respectively.

Telmiwal-40 Tablet works by blocking the action of a hormone called angiotensin II in the body. This hormone causes blood vessels to narrow, leading to high blood pressure. By blocking this action, Telmiwal-40 Tablet widens and relaxes blood vessels, lowering high blood pressure.

You can take Telmiwal-40 Tablet irrespective of food and swallow it whole with a glass of water. Do not crush, chew, or break it. Your doctor will tell you how often you should take your tablets based on your medical condition. In some cases, you may experience diarrhoea, sinus infection, back pain, or low blood pressure. Most of these side effects of Telmiwal-40 Tablet do not require medical attention and gradually resolve over time. However, if the side effects persist, please consult your doctor.

Telmiwal-40 Tablet is not for pregnant women as its use during your pregnancy can cause injury and even death to your unborn baby. It is not known whether Telmiwal-40 Tablet passes into your breast milk or not. Your doctor will decide if you will take Telmiwal-40 Tablet while using Telmiwal-40 Tablet and breastfeeding together. Prolonged intake of Telmiwal-40 Tablet may cause high potassium in the blood (hyperkalemia). Avoid potassium supplements with Telmiwal-40 Tablet as they may lead to high potassium levels in the blood, so the doctor may ask you to check your potassium level regularly. Do not consume alcohol with Telmiwal-40 Tablet as it may increase the risk of low blood pressure. Taking Telmiwal-40 Tablet with painkillers (like aspirin and ibuprofen) can increase the risk of kidney problems and reduce the efficiency of Telmiwal-40 Tablet .

Telmiwal-40 Tablet is used to treat high blood pressure and reduce the risk of heart attack or stroke. It is an angiotensin II receptor blocker that decreases high blood pressure by widening and relaxing the blood vessels by blocking the action of a hormone called angiotensin II in the body. Angiotensin II causes blood vessels to narrow, leading to high blood pressure.

Do not take more than the prescribed dose of Telmiwal-40 Tablet as it may cause overdose. If you suspect you have taken overdose, please consult a doctor immediately.

Telmiwal-40 Tablet is not recommended for people with impaired kidney function, diabetes or severe liver problems. Telmiwal-40 Tablet may increase the risk of low blood pressure when taken with alcohol. Telmiwal-40 Tablet may cause tiredness or dizziness in some people. Make sure you are not affected before driving. Breastfeeding women are advised to consult a doctor before taking Telmiwal-40 Tablet .   • Maintain a low-salt diet and avoid processed foods, which contain more sodium. Try to replace salt with spices or herbs to add flavour to the food.
  • Regular exercise such as cycling, walking, jogging, dancing, or swimming should be done for a minimum of 30 minutes daily.
  • Chronic stress may also cause high blood pressure. Therefore, avoid stress by changing your expectations, adjusting to how you react in certain situations, and making time for yourself to do activities you enjoy.
  • Maintain a diet that is rich in fruits, vegetables, whole grains, and low-fat dairy products.
  • Avoid smoking and alcohol intake.

Your blood pressure may be decreased during the first 2 weeks of treatment. However, it might take 4 weeks for you to notice the full benefit of Telmiwal-40 Tablet .
Telmiwal-40 Tablet should not be discontinued without a doctor's consultation as stopping Telmiwal-40 Tablet may cause blood pressure to return to pre-treatment levels within a few days. Therefore, continue taking Telmiwal-40 Tablet even if you feel well. Consult the doctor if you have any concerns.
Before starting Telmiwal-40 Tablet inform the doctor if you have kidney problems as it might worsen the condition. You may need a lower dose in such cases. Consult the doctor if you notice unexplained weight gain or swelling in the hands, feet or ankles.
Do not worry as Telmiwal-40 Tablet may not cause weight gain. However, consult the doctor if you notice unexplained weight gain as it could be a sign of kidney problems.
Telmiwal-40 Tablet might lower blood glucose levels. Therefore, inform the doctor if you have diabetes. Regular monitoring of blood sugar levels is advised.
Yes, Telmiwal-40 Tablet may cause hyperkalemia (high potassium level in blood). The doctor may monitor your potassium levels as needed.
No, Telmiwal-40 Tablet does not work by causing excessive urination. It works by relaxing the blood vessels and improving blood flow.
